Well….technically it’s clay, Bentonite clay. For those who do not have a clue what it is: Bentonite clay is an impure clay that forms as a result of aged/weathering volcanic ash and water.  It’s an ideal clay for cleansing and detoxifying, as it has the ability to remove positively charged (cationic) conditioners and products that can build…

My first co-wash :)

What is co-washing? Cowashing is washing your hair with conditioner in the same way you would using shampoo. Its great for quick midweek washes when you don’t have time and for people with TWA’s (teenie weenie afro’s) who tend to wash their hair quite often.
